What Samsung Frame TV Offer?

  • The Samsung Frame TV has a 4K QLED display with Quantum Dot technology for delivering vibrant colors, deep contrast, and stunning detail in every scene.
  • Samsung Frame TV has a Matte Display with anti-reflection coating for minimizing glare and providing a realistic, canvas-like look even in bright rooms.
  • It has Art Mode for displaying artwork or personal photos when not in use to transform the screen into a customizable digital gallery.
  • The Samsung Frame TV has customizable bezels to change the frame style & match your home decor and interior design preferences.
  • Samsung Frame TV has a Slim Fit Wall Mount that allows the TV to sit flush against the wall like a real picture frame & enhance its aesthetic appeal.
  • It has a Motion Sensor for detecting presence in the room and automatically turning Art Mode on or off to save power and improve usability.
  • The Samsung Frame TV has Tizen OS for delivering fast performance, smooth app navigation, and access to streaming platforms like Netflix, Disney+, and YouTube.
  • Samsung Frame TV has a One Connect Box with an invisible cable for reducing clutter and simplifying cable management.

FAQ

Is the Samsung Frame TV suitable for bright rooms?
Yes, the Frame TV features a matte display with anti-reflection technology that makes it ideal for bright environments, significantly reducing glare and maintaining visibility even in daylight.

Does the Samsung Frame TV support 4K HDR content?
Yes, it supports 4K HDR including HDR10, HDR10+, and HLG, delivering enhanced contrast and dynamic range for a more immersive viewing experience.

What is Art Mode, and how does it work?
Art Mode turns your TV into a digital picture frame when it’s not in use. You can display classic artworks or your own photos, and it will adjust brightness based on room lighting for a realistic look.

Can I change the frame on the Samsung Frame TV?
Yes, Samsung offers interchangeable customizable bezels in various colors and styles that attach magnetically, allowing you to match the frame to your room’s aesthetic.

Does it come with a wall mount?
Yes, a Slim Fit Wall Mount is included, letting you hang the TV flush against the wall just like a real piece of framed art.

What streaming apps are supported on the Frame TV?
All major apps are supported, including Netflix, Disney+, Prime Video, Hulu, YouTube, and more via Samsung’s Tizen smart platform.

Is there a monthly fee for Art Mode?
You can use your own photos for free, but to access the premium collection of artworks in the Samsung Art Store, a subscription is required.

How many HDMI ports does the Samsung Frame TV have?
It includes four HDMI ports via the One Connect Box, including at least one HDMI 2.1 port for gaming and high-bandwidth video.

Is the Frame TV good for gaming?
Yes, it supports Auto Low Latency Mode (ALLM), HDMI 2.1, and variable refresh rate (VRR) for smooth gameplay, making it suitable for next-gen consoles.

Can the TV be used without the Art Mode?
Absolutely. Art Mode is optional, and you can use the Frame TV like a normal smart TV at all times if you prefer.

How do I upload my own photos to the Frame TV?
You can upload personal photos using the SmartThings app on your smartphone, making it easy to customize your home gallery.

Does the TV work with smart assistants like Alexa or Google Assistant?
Yes, it supports both Alexa and Google Assistant, and also includes Samsung’s Bixby for voice control directly through the remote.

How is the sound quality on the Frame TV?
The sound is decent with built-in speakers, and it supports Dolby Digital Plus. For a richer experience, many users pair it with a Samsung soundbar.

Does it have an ambient light sensor?
Yes, it has a brightness sensor that adjusts the screen based on surrounding light to make the artwork look natural and energy-efficient.

Is it easy to set up out of the box?
Yes, setup is straightforward with a guided walkthrough. The One Connect Box simplifies cable management, and the SmartThings app helps with quick configuration.
